actually, it's chrome's bug, which is fixed already, and I believe the fix will be included in the next release of chrome.
see also http://code.google.com/p/chromium/issues/detail?id=62123 for users who want it now, I attached the workaround patch too. best wishes sunnavy On 10-11-25 08:35, sunnavy wrote: > it's indeed a bug of fckeditor, I have filed a bug report, > see http://dev.ckeditor.com/ticket/6717 > > best wishes > sunnavy > > On 10-11-22 14:26, Gary Holmes wrote: > > Hi all, > > > > We're using RT 3.8.4 on Ubuntu 10.10. I've noticed recently that the > > textarea that is used to input comments on tickets is not displaying when > > I'm using Google Chrome. I have 9.0.587.0 but the issue occurred on releases > > prior to that. Nothing has changed for our setup except the updates to > > Chrome, so I'm assuming that it's related. > > > > If I use IE or Firefox - no problem. > > > > From the source produced by .../Ticket/Update.html, in firefox: > > > > <textarea class="messagebox" cols="72" rows="15" name="UpdateContent" id= > > "UpdateContent"> > > > > In Chrome: > > > > <textarea class="messagebox" cols="72" rows="15" name="UpdateContent" > > id="UpdateContent" style="display: none; "> > > > > I suspect this behavior is programmed in. It used to work OK. Is there > > a workaround or a fix for this? > > > > Thanks, > > > > Gary
